Yes. LiFePO4 is an inherently safe chemistry and the most stable lithium-type battery on the market. LiTime lithium cells are UL certified for the highest safety and sustainability standards. All LiTime LiFePO4 batteries come with an internal Battery Management System which protects against under-voltage during discharge, over-voltage during charge, over-current during discharge, over-temperature during charge and discharge, and short-circuit protection – protects battery cells from damage. Additionally, LiTime LiFePO4 Lithium batteries have been tested to be free from the risk of fire, and electric shock in harsh environments.

Please be aware that this 400Ah model does not featured low-temp protection and should only be charged when the battery's temperature is above 32°F (0°C). Charging in freezing temperatures will damage the cells. On cold days, the best practice is to bring the battery indoors to charge.

Proper storage is the key to ensuring your LiTime LiFePO4 battery delivers years of reliable performance. Follow these simple steps to protect your investment when the battery is not in use.
1. Aim for a 50% Charge
Before storing, bring your battery to approximately 50% State of Charge (SOC). Avoid leaving it fully charged or completely empty. For storage longer than three months, simply recharge it back to 50% every 3 months to keep the cells healthy and balanced.
2. Disconnect from Your System
Ensure the battery is completely disconnected from all chargers and devices (loads). This prevents "phantom drains" that can slowly deplete the battery and cause irreversible damage over time.
3. Find the Right Environment
Store your battery in a cool, dry, and stable location.
4. Keep it Protected
We recommend storing your battery in a battery box. This shields it from moisture, dust, and accidental impacts, ensuring it's in perfect condition when you need it next.
5. "Waking Up" After Storage
After a long storage period, it's best practice to "wake up" the battery with one complete cycle (a full charge followed by a full discharge) before putting it back into regular service.
